Forum | JCS: Unable to update Start and Expirey dates in Edit User Subscription | ||
|
I am unable to edit the Start and Expiry Dates in User Subscriptions.
Whenever I update the dates, and hit Update or Save, the fields get filled with zeroes and database doesn't get updated. |

I have the same problem, same symptoms, only using MySQL5. Providing you with FTP access is not a solution, since we are developing the site offline on a non-Internet-connected server. (Will not post to live server until it works<g>.) So please post details if you find a substantive solution! Also interesting is that my testing shows that I *can* successfully update the "Access Limit" field, so it is not that the data update is not happening... it is just losing the Start Date and Expire Date values. It sure seems like a problem with the SQL or date formats, etc, but Joomla! debug does not seem to capture the JCS MySQL commands for adding or updating a subscription, so I am stuck unless I set up a full debug session (and my Zend Studio is broken. ).Thanks, -t |
